UK to rejoin Erasmus: what this means for scholarships and EU student fees
The UK Government has confirmed that Britain will rejoin the Erasmus+ programme from 2027, restoring opportunities for UK students to study abroad and signalling a potential reset in UK–EU relations.

Budget 2025: What the new International Student Levy means for fees and scholarships
On Wednesday 26 November 2025, the UK Government confirmed in the Autumn Budget a new international student levy that will reshape the higher education landscape. The levy will charge universities £925 per international student per year of study from August 2028.

UK Graduate Route shortened to 18 months from January 2027 - what international students starting in January 2026 need to know
The UK Home Office has confirmed that the Graduate Route visa will be reduced from two years to 18 months from 1 January 2027. This change will affect international students who plan to remain in the UK after completing their studies. If you start a UK master’s in January 2026, you may be among the final group of students eligible for the two-year Graduate Route. This only applies if you complete your course and secure your visa before the end of 2026.
